The Israel Defense Forces (IDF) say troops from the 91st Division have carried out a series of operations in southern Lebanon, targeting Hezbollah-linked militants and infrastructure.
According to an IDF statement, forces operating in the area recently identified a militant cell near their positions, Caliber.Az reports.
One individual was observed taking cover in vegetation and was subsequently struck in an Israeli Air Force (IAF) operation directed by ground troops. The IDF also reported that a vehicle carrying additional members of the same group, who were attempting to flee, was hit during the operation.
The IDF said its air force continues to support ground operations in the area, including strikes on a weapons storage facility and other infrastructure sites it attributes to Hezbollah.
Over the past week, the military said more than 40 militants were killed and over 50 sites linked to Hezbollah were dismantled as part of ongoing operations directed by the 91st Division.
